I have a Nikon D300s as a hand me down, I have had it for a few years, but I don't ever remember trying to use the top 3 buttons (I have not used the camera a whole lot, just now really getting in to photography) and, well they don't work, for how long, I have no idea. I was just wondering, or maybe it's a pointless hope, that it is something in the software. Unfortunately though, I don't think my chances for that are all that great, as the piece of plastic that holds the three buttons is able to spin. So, is there a deep hidden setting that you could help me navigate to? Also, if not, do I have any real chance of Nikon doing anything about it? At the very least though, I think I would be fine if I am just able to set the FN+wheel to ISO, but I was not able to figure out how to do that, there is no obvious option for it where you change the use of that button. You can remove the back of the camera but be careful of the flexable cable that connects to the Image PCB.  The connectors are very delicate to open and lock.  You can just clean up the contacts inside the camera back and put it back together.  Is there still access to the menus?  If so you should be able to change your settings there and you can ignore the buttons that don't work.  Good Luck
